Releases: github-linguist/linguist
Releases · github-linguist/linguist
v4.5.9 release
Merge pull request #2500 from github/cut-release-v4.5.9 Cut release v4.5.9
v4.5.8 release
v4.5.6 release
Changes since v4.5.5: 6062d3b...468fd42
Pull requests
- Add PicoLisp language #2449 (larsbrinkhoff)
- Switch to using atom-fsharp language definition #2445 (rneatherway)
- Improved XQuery and JSONiq support #2443 (wcandillon)
- fix anchor link to vim & emacs modelines section #2439 (alexweber)
- .qbs extension for QML. #2432 (jakepetroules)
- New .al extension for Perl #2431 (pchaigno)
- Make filename: Kbuild #2429 (larsbrinkhoff)
- Detect Go files generated by go-bindata #2426 (tamird)
- Fix Rust heuristic. #2425 (larsbrinkhoff)
- Add Smali language #2422 (CalebFenton)
- Treat Carthage path as vendored #2419 (evgenyneu)
- Add JRuby executable example, fixes #2412 #2413 (yegortimoschenko)
- Display IntelliJ configurations files as XML #2410 (SimenB)
- Adding back Handlebars grammar #2407 (arfon)
- Fix Handlebars grammar #2405 (aroben)
- Cut release v4.5.5 #2401 (arfon)
- Add Apache thrift support to generated? check #2392 (vighnesh1987)
- Add Lex and Yacc languages #2390 (larsbrinkhoff)
- More file extensions for Groff #2383 (larsbrinkhoff)
- Added support for .mdpolicy XML files #2378 (Mailaender)
- .vhost as a Nginx extension #2203 (pchaigno)
- An example comparison for docs #2453 (federicoleon)
- Improved XQuery and JSONiq support #2436 (wcandillon)
- Work in progress: .com #2435 (larsbrinkhoff)
- Add docs on how highlighting works abogala85@ #2420 (abol)
- An example comparison for docs #2406 (aaronwinter)
- Update languages.yml #2395 (mark-shamy)
- Only require heuristics to match subset of candidates #2359 (bkeepers)
- Adding Quartz Composer #2344 (ankurp)
v4.5.5 release
Changes since v4.5.4
: 78d4abe...3878afa
- Improving Vim modeline regex #2394 (arfon)
- Added fastlane configuration files #2393 (KrauseFx)
- Add Unity3D Asset and Metadata files #2388 (mephaust)
- Change PHP group to HTML for TWIG #2387 (aivus)
- Vim and Emacs modelines are two alternatives #2386 (larsbrinkhoff)
- Add HyPhy as language to Linguist #2375 (mbdoud)
- Handle SSH links to submodules in Travis #2374 (pchaigno)
- Remove unused grammars/submodules #2373 (pchaigno)
- Use original Ada grammar #2372 (pchaigno)
- Add languages.yml entry and sample files for OGC Geography Markup Language (#2366) #2368 (vog)
- Add support for API Blueprint #2363 (danielgtaylor)
- Add support for SSH2 and OpenSSH public keys #2346 (larsbrinkhoff)
- Remove .script! hack #2340 (bkeepers)
- Improve NL/NewLisp disambiguation heuristic #2339 (vitaut)
- Change Salt to programming per #2307 #2335 (DavidJFelix)
- Update submodule for Chapel grammar. #2334 (thomasvandoren)
- Add additional Puppet sample #2333 (3flex)
- Add 'Linker Script' language #2330 (larsbrinkhoff)
- Specflow #2328 (arfon)
- Add DCL and MMS #2326 (arfon)
- Adding support for Clarion #2325 (arfon)
- Remove Batch from Shell group #2324 (pchaigno)
- Add JFlex grammars (language & syntax highlighting) #2323 (lsf37)
- Make Common Lisp heuristic case insensitive. #2322 (larsbrinkhoff)
- Tighten up OCaml heuristic #2314 (larsbrinkhoff)
- New sample for Formatted. #2312 (larsbrinkhoff)
- New samples for SaltStack #2311 (pchaigno)
- KiCad language with .sch extension #2309 (pchaigno)
- Update guideline on syntax highlighting fixes #2308 (pchaigno)
- add Limbo: language, samples #2306 (powerman)
- Explaining gitattributes behavior. #2304 (arfon)
- Add rebar-related files as erlang. #2301 (dpiddy)
- Adding in a Makefile.boot filename for .boot detection #2300 (arfon)
- Fixing up shebang detection to match new tokenizer behaviour #2299 (arfon)
- Add proximity test for colors #2298 (gjtorikian)
- Add colors to semi-popular languages #2296 (phase)
- Add .ruby to the list of ruby file extensions #2266 (Dorian)
- Add support for the Clarion language #1770 (fushnisoft)
- Comment styles; don't choke on
\#!/usr/bin/env foo=bar
#1604 (geoff-codes) - add DCL and MMS/MMK files commonly used in OpenVMS environments #1573 (ztmr)
- Add support for SVG #2391 (stanhu)
- Add .test extention as xml filetype #2380 (wkentaro)
- Add EusLisp #2379 (wkentaro)
- An example comparison for docs #2371 (stl-sanjay)
- Remove executable flag from all sample code files #2369 (vog)
- Deadfish language #2358 (phase)
- Marking XCode .pbxproj as generated #2351 (arfon)
- Extensions for the Bazel build system are written in a Python dialect #2348 (hanwen)
- Analyse an individual file using repository information. #2342 (larsbrinkhoff)
- More Language Colors #2337 (phase)
- An example comparison for docs #2327 (Rahat-3858)
- Fixing incorrect detection of the NewLisp language #2319 (Ignotus)
- Add Libraries & Libs to vendor.yml #2302 (phase)
- Call out fact that language updates are post-push #2093 (arfon)
- Add ColdC, the language from ColdMUD. #2091 (waywardmonkeys)
- Add Clojure support for .boot files #1894 (alandipert)
- Add .xml.fr and .html.fr #1830 (larsbrinkhoff)
- Remove .script! hack #1786 (bkeepers)
- use syntax hilighting for uncompilable codeblocks #1713 (oli-obk)
- Add more extensions to Logos language #1562 (Tyilo)
- Add support for Drupal's inc, module and install extensions #1343 (jacobbednarz)
v4.5.4 release
Full Changelog since last release
Merged pull requests:
- Grammars update #2294 (arfon)
- Some tests to go with #2290 #2293 (arfon)
- Added Color for the Squirrel Language #2291 (iFarbod)
- Ignore assets from Sphinx docs #2290 (untitaker)
- add tests/fixtures to vendor.yml #2289 (lepture)
- Adding puphpet to vendored list #2286 (arfon)
- Add .odd to XML extensions #2279 (joewiz)
- Fix ada aliases #2276 (MakeNowJust)
- Bump escape-utils to 1.1.0 #2275 (ptoomey3)
- intro.wisp: Fixed typographical error ('rather then' -> 'rather than'). #2274 (csimons)
- Elixir: Add mix.lock filename #2272 (lpil)
- Add interpreters for OCaml. #2270 (larsbrinkhoff)
- Use #80 for Lua color #2269 (stuartpb)
- Add RenderScript and Filterscript #2247 (larsbrinkhoff)
- fix emacs modeline parsing #2233 (tesch1)
- Add cpplint.py to vendor.yml #2075 (philix)
- exclude puphpet dir from language #2026 (Atriedes)
v4.5.3 release
Merged pull requests:
- Updating grammars #2264 (arfon)
- Net linx #2263 (arfon)
- Fix categorization for Racket shell scripts. #2262 (drautb)
- .storyboard and .xib as XML #2261 (ntkme)
- Bump rugged to latest release #2259 (adelcambre)
- Adding tm_scope for REBOL language and removing REBOL from LICENSE_WHITE... #2257 (Oldes)
- Added grammar submodule for Red language #2256 (Oldes)
- add .boot to clojure extensions #2254 (shaunlebron)
- Fix Emacs modeline in DTrace sample. #2253 (larsbrinkhoff)
- Add Neovim config file names to VimL language #2250 (shaneog)
- Add a heuristic to disambiguate between NL and NewLisp #2246 (vitaut)
- Fix the type classification of some languages. #2242 (larsbrinkhoff)
- Detect generated source maps #2213 (ntkme)
- Added NetLinx language. #2101 (amclain)
v4.5.2 release
Changes: v4.5.1...ebf10c2
Merged pull requests:
- Give Diff a color #2236 (Phasesaber)
- Disambiguate between OCaml and Standard ML #2227 (samoht)
- languages.yml: don't assume .conf is Apache #2222 (chriskuehl)
- Assign handlebars a color for the language bar. #2198 (tarebyte)
- Some .for files are text. #2123 (larsbrinkhoff)
v4.5.1 release
Merged Pull Requests since last release:
- Standardized color hexcode length to 6 #2178
- Description of group attribute #2231
- .jbuilder as a Ruby extension #2202
- Exclude gettext catalogues from statistics #2204
- Update popular languages #2207
- Add .plsql as extension for PL/SQL #2209
- apt-get update before downloading deps #2215
- Detect *.sma files as SourcePawn #2218
- Simplifying requires #2224
- Grammar for Perl6 #2229
v4.4.3 release
Merged Pull Requests since last release:
- New Mathematica (aka Wolfram Language) extensions added #2024
- PL/SQL PLpgSQL and SQLPL #2175
- Detection by extension made case-insensitive #2087
- Added a sample of a C header file that is currently recognized as C++ #2102
- Mark XS files as "type: programming" #2112
- tcc interpreter for C #2147
- Detect Go files generated by Protocol Buffers #2152
- Test that languages have a type #2153
- Support for .pro INI files (KiCad project files) #2154
- Classify Brainfuck as a programming language and include samples #2143
- add support for Lean Theorem Prover #2151
- Finding by alias too. #2158
- Add instrumentation to detection and classification #2162
- Add MUF - Multi-user Forth #2145
- Add to .d: DTrace and Makefile dependencies #2128
- Add support for the AMPL modeling and script language #2176
- Grammar for OpenSCAD #2174
- Instrument all calls and pass the blob, strategy and language candidates in the payload. #2173
- More specific heuristic for Prolog #2181
- Add designated color of eC language for display in language bar. #2184
- Add colour for XMOS XC in linguist #2188
- Support for NL file format #2193
- Added XC syntax #2192
- GLSL should not be in the C group #2196
v4.3.1
Changes since v4.3.0
v4.3.0...b8f3078
Added htmlbars
as an alias for Handlebars: #2000
Grammars for 8 languages: #2064
ATS language support: #2057
Add .4TH Forth extension: #2072
Update URL for AutoHotkey grammar: #2058
'Text' shouldn't qualify as a valid modeline language. #2063
Support of Modelica language: #2059